A video game studio is tuning two weapons so that they deal identical damage at every player level L. Weapon A deals (3/8)(16L - 24) + cL + 7 points of damage, and Weapon B deals 2(6L - 1) - L points of damage, where c is a constant.

If the two expressions give the same damage for every value of L, what is the value of c?

Answer: 5

Weapon A simplifies to 6L - 9 + cL + 7 = (6 + c)L - 2. Weapon B simplifies to 12L - 2 - L = 11L - 2. For the equation (6 + c)L - 2 = 11L - 2 to hold for every value of L, the coefficients of L must be equal: 6 + c = 11, so c = 5. (The constant terms are already equal, -2 = -2, which is what makes infinitely many solutions possible.)

Common wrong answers

If you answered 6
You dropped the -L at the end of Weapon B: 2(6L - 1) - L is 11L - 2, not 12L - 2, so 6 + c = 11 and c = 5.
If you answered 11
That's the coefficient of L in Weapon B's simplified form, but Weapon A already contributes 6L on its own, so c must make 6 + c = 11.
If you answered -5
You reversed the subtraction: 6 + c = 11 gives c = 11 - 6 = 5, not 6 - 11.
